使用Python查询SAP数据库

Python是最常用的面向对象编程语言之一,非常易于编码和理解。

为了将Python与SAP结合使用,我们需要安装Python SAP RFC模块,即PyRFC。它的可用方法之一是RFC_READ_TABLE,可以调用该方法以从SAP数据库中的表读取数据。

同样,PyRFC包提供了各种绑定,可以使用这两种方式进行调用。我们可以用来从ABAP模块到Python模块进行调用,也可以反过来进行调用。可以定义用于数据交换的等效SAP数据类型。

另外,我们可以使用Python创建可用于相互通信的Web服务。SAP NetWeaver与Web服务完全兼容,无论是完全状态还是无状态。